Skip to content

Latest commit

 

History

History
94 lines (78 loc) · 1.33 KB

0005.A+B问题VII.md

File metadata and controls

94 lines (78 loc) · 1.33 KB

5. A+B问题VII

题目链接

C++

#include<iostream>
using namespace std;
int main() {
    int a, b;
    while (cin >> a >> b) cout << a + b << endl << endl;
}

Java

import java.util.Scanner;
public class Main{
    public static void main(String[] args){
        Scanner sc = new Scanner(System.in);
        while(sc.hasNextLine()){
            int a = sc.nextInt();
            int b = sc.nextInt();
            System.out.println(a + b);
            System.out.println();
        }
    }
}

python

while True:
    try:
        x, y = map(int, (input().split()))
        print(x + y)
        print()
    except:
        break

Go

package main

import "fmt"

func main() {
	var a, b int
	for {
		_, err := fmt.Scan(&a, &b)
		if err != nil {
			break
		}
		fmt.Printf("%d\n\n", a+b)
	}
}

Js

const readline=require('readline');
const rl=readline.createInterface({
    input:process.stdin,
    output:process.stdout
});
function Sum(){
    rl.on("line",(input)=>{
        const [a,b]=input.split(' ').map(Number);
        console.log(a+b+"\n");
    });
}
Sum();

C

#include <stdio.h>

int main()
{
    int a, b;
    while(scanf("%d%d",&a,&b)!=EOF){
        printf("%d\n\n",a+b);
    }
    return 0;
}